It's a bit off topic, bit my favourite corruption story that I tell non-Belgians is the titres-services/dienstencheques racket. Titres-services/dienstencheques is a kind of money that can be used only for household tasks. Think cleaning lady. At the introduction, they costed ~4.70€/hour to the public while designated organisations cashed in 21€/hour. The gap narrowed later, after creating a few nouveau riches, and af…
Another case: present government (rightwing) has lowered the taxes (very significantly) you have to pay when buying a new home. Objective: help people with less financial resources to get a home. What happened so far: price of the houses raised to absorb that new purchasing power. Minister's comment: "people now can buy better quality homes".
